Two Suspects Arrested in String of Local Burglaries

A home burglary crime "spree" stretched from Wayne to Malvern.

Tredyffrin Township Police have arrested two men believed to be behind a six-month home burglary spree.

Police say 24-year-old  Christopher “Matt” Fazzini of Avonwood Drive in Wayne, and 22-year old Brendan White Burke of Spruce Lane in Berwyn were arrested last Thursday. Information about the arrests was released Monday, July 9.

According to a Tredyffrin Police news release, the two men were arrested in connection with a home burglary crime "spree" that stretched from Malvern to Wayne, including Berwyn.

According to police, Fazzini and Burke are charged in a string of crimes that began on November 26, 2011 and continued through March 2 of this year.  Police say burglars in the crimes "commonly had knowledge of the occupants and/or their whereabouts."

Police say the pair typically did not use force to get into the homes they are accused of burglarizing. According to police the items stolen in the burglaries were pawned in the greater Philadelphia area and are "reported to be a means to support drug habits."
